I just tried my D2HS tethered to a Mac Book Pro with PM open and set to live slide show.
  No images appeared on screen or in the selected file using the "P" option (PTP) on the camera. When I used "M" setting instead the camera didn't operate at all. The IB for the camera says to use either setting when using Nikon software.

Any tethered Nikon users here have a solution?

No I am only running PM.  Do I still need to own/run or use Nikon Camera Control even if I have PM?

Yes, because PM does not have any code in it to control any cameras, you'll still need to use some software to control the camera, making it copy the photos to a specific folder on your computer.  Then you would point the Live Slide Show at that same folder and then your images will appear in PM.
